Impact #2…Technology increases higher-order thinking skills.

“Research and evaluation shows that technology can enable the development of critical thinking skills when students

use technology presentation and communication tools to present,

publish, and share results of projects.”(Cradler, 2002)

Impact #4…Technology serves for helping teachers in their teaching styles.

Technology Tools

Uses

Talk Board For students who struggle with

communicating

Document Camera

For students who are visually learners and benefit from

modeling

Adapted Mouse For students with motor difficulties

Amplification System

For speech-impaired or hard

of hearing students

“Lesson planning should focus first on content and classroom strategies, then on ways in which

technologies can enhance the lesson.” (Brabec, p. 11)
